Enzo Fernandez drops Chelsea team news hint before Liverpool clash amid Graham Potter exit

Enzo Fernandez may have dropped a potential hint over the Chelsea team news hours before the side are set to take on Liverpool in the Premier League. The Blues will be hopeful of making a return to winning ways after falling to a 2-0 defeat against Aston Villa on Saturday.

However, it has been a turbulent few days since the result at Stamford Bridge, with a huge change coming in the dugout. Head coach Graham Potter was dismissed from his duties on Sunday evening, with a club statement confirming that he and assistant Billy Reid were leaving.

It means that the west London side go into the clash with the Reds without a manager at the helm, with former Brighton captain Bruno Saltor taking interim charge instead. It's a huge step for the Spaniard, who is still relatively fresh in his coaching journey since retiring from his playing career.

"I've been coaching for four years and I've been under Graham, he's been the manager and always had the last word," said Bruno in his pre-match press conference duties. "It's quite clear that's not going to be the case. Tomorrow is going to be the first time [selecting a starting XI]. I feel good, it's my duty, it's a responsibility and I'm in a really important club and I want to try my best."

The question for many will be whether the interim boss decides to stick with a fairly similar team that dominated Villa, despite the loss, or make radical changes. Midfield star Fernandez may have answered that with a team news hint posted on social media ahead of the tie.

The World Cup winner put a hype graphic on his Instagram story ahead of the game, potentially hinting at a start for the clash. That could be the case, though it isn't always as sometimes players that post them may not feature as it remains to be seen what Bruno's first Chelsea 11 looks like.
